Amazon Air Fryers on Sale: How to Find the Best Deals

Air fryers are a staple in small kitchens and a frequent wish-list item on Amazon, offering a simpler way to crisp food with less oil. On sale, they can feel like an irresistible bargain, yet choices vary widely in size, performance, and smart features. This guide explains how to read specifications, compare true value across models, and recognize meaningful discounts, giving you the confidence to shop with clarity rather than impulse. You will learn which factors matter most over time and how to judge whether a deal fits your cooking habits.

What to compare before you add an air fryer to your cart

Before hunting for sale prices, clarify what an air fryer does and how those functions matter to your everyday cooking. Focus on capacity, power, basket style, and the control system, because these determine what you can cook and how consistently. Remembered details like size, footprint, and cleaning effort are equally important, since a large, hard-to-clean unit often becomes a shelf ornament. By defining your must-haves first, you can quickly filter out models that will not work in your space or habits.

Capacity and portion size ranges

Capacity affects meal type, not just how many people you can feed. Small units under 3 quarts are best for snacks and sides, while 4-quart models suit families or meal prep, and 5-quart and larger models allow whole chickens or multi-rack cooking. Measured capacity in quarts or liters reflects the usable interior space, yet the actual layout matters too, because basket shape and height influence what fits. If you plan sheet pan meals or family-sized batches, prioritize capacity and interior clearance over raw power alone.

Power, heat, and cooking performance

Most modern air fryers operate between 1,400 and 1,800 watts, with higher wattage generally enabling faster heating and crisping. Consistent 360°F airflow and a responsive heating element help replicate restaurant-style results for frozen foods, roasted vegetables, and reheated leftovers. Some brands pair rapid air technology with top or rear heating elements to reduce undercooking and hot spots. Compare fan speed settings, temperature range, and whether the control system allows precise adjustments rather than simple presets.

Basket design and accessories

Basket style influences handling, capacity efficiency, and cleaning. Paddle-free baskets reduce clutter and nudge food more gently, while racks and dividers support multi-layer cooking without mixing flavors. Common accessories include grill racks, baking trays, and reusable liners, yet not every accessory suits every model. Check whether replacements are sold separately, how dishwasher-safe parts are, and whether the basket nonstick surface remains durable over hundreds of uses.

Controls, interfaces, and smart features

Basic dials suit straightforward cooking, while digital interfaces with presets simplify common tasks like fries, chicken, or dehydrating. Smart models offer app connectivity, guided programs, and manual adjustments that mirror countertop ovens, but complexity can introduce learning curves and occasional software hiccups. Consider whether timer precision, temperature control, and auto-shutoff features align with your skill level and the types of meals you prepare.

How to interpret sale listings and compare true value

Sale prices on Amazon appear as percent-off banners, coupon discounts, and limited-time deals that may or may not stack. Lists may blend unit price, total savings, and lower-priced variants with slightly different specs, making direct comparison confusing. Others hinge on shipping eligibility, coupons, or add-on purchase rules. Focus on the final price after all discounts, then compare it to historical averages, manufacturer direct listings, and reputable retailers to gauge real value.

Lists that clarify common deal structures

  • Percent-off banners reflect markdowns from the current list price and may reset without notice
  • Clip coupons and promo codes can stack with sales for deeper discounts but sometimes require minimum spend
  • Subscribe & Save or subscription boxes bundle accessories, cleaning supplies, or replacement parts, which may or may not suit your needs
  • Renewed or Used-like-New offers can lower upfront cost but may remove standard warranty protections

Understanding listings, offers, and availability on Amazon

Amazon listings can vary across sellers, markets, and time, so key details matter. Shipping eligibility, warehouse location, and delivery windows influence total cost and arrival time, especially during peak periods. Returns, operational pauses, or restock delays can change the purchasing experience quickly. Always verify current eligibility, warranty terms, and return policy details directly on the product page before checkout, even when a deal looks appealing.

Fast facts table for air fryer comparison and buying decisions

Attribute Verified Detail Why It Matters
Typical capacity range 3–6+ quarts Determines meal type and family suitability
Power range 1,400–1,800 watts Higher wattage can mean faster crisping and recovery
Basket styles Paddle-free, rack, divider options Impacts handling, capacity efficiency, and cleaning
Temperature range Often 175°F–400°F (80°C–205°C) Wider range supports more cooking techniques
Smart connectivity App-enabled presets and guided programs Useful for some users, optional for others
Typical warranty length 1–3 years depending on brand and model Longer coverage can offset higher upfront cost

How to read reviews and assess long-term value

Reviews highlight real-world performance, durability, and quirks that spec sheets miss. Prioritizing verified purchase reviews, long-term ownership reports, and critical comments about noise, reliability, and customer service offers a fuller picture. Look for patterns over time, such as repeated complaints about basket warping, control panel failures, or uneven cooking. Balance enthusiastic comments about crispiness and speed against reports of inconsistent results, difficult cleaning, or part availability issues.

Questions to ask when reviewing user feedback

  • Do users mention long-term durability after one to two years of use?
  • Are cleaning and basket maintenance described as easy or labor-intensive?
  • How often do users report uneven cooking or temperature drift?
  • What do reviewers say about noise level and countertop footprint?
  • Are replacement baskets and customer service responsive and accessible?

Trusted brands and what they typically offer

Several brands appear frequently on Amazon with varied model tiers and features. Established names often back their products with clearer warranty terms, more consistent build quality, and wider replacement-part availability. Budget-friendly options may simplify controls and capacity to lower cost, while higher-end models emphasize precise temperature control, larger capacities, and app integration. Matching brand positioning to your cooking volume, kitchen space, and feature preferences reduces decision noise.

How to spot real savings and avoid gimmicky deals

Real savings on Amazon combine market-competitive pricing, meaningful discounts, and long-term usability. A lower upfront price loses value if the model lacks capacity, has poor temperature consistency, or requires frequent replacement. Compare final price per quart of usable capacity, verify warranty coverage, and check whether replacement baskets and filters remain available years later. If a deal hinges on obscure coupon stacking or limited-time urgency, consider whether the risk to durability and support is worth the short-term reduction.

Steps to finalize your purchase with confidence

Confirm your kitchen layout and counter space, decide on the right capacity for your household, and define which features you will actually use. Use Amazon filters to narrow by capacity, power, basket style, smart features, and customer rating, then review verified purchase comments focused on durability and performance. Compare the final price to historical ranges and ensure shipping, return windows, and warranty terms meet your expectations. Choosing this way keeps the focus on long-term value rather than momentary headlines, making every sale more sustainable.
